Revision as of 05:08, 26 July 2019

Nomenclatural details

Taeniothrips pediculae Han, 1988: 179.

Yaothrips shii Mirab-Balou, Wei, Lu & Chen, 2011: 47. Synonymised by Mirab-balou et al. 2015.

Biology and Distribution

Described from Tibet; shii described from Dangxiong county, Lhasa city, Tibet from grasses.

Type information

Unknown. Holotype female of shii, Institute of Insect Sciences, Zhejiang University, Hangzhou.
